An innovative graduate course, “Technologies for ESG-transformation,” was developed at HSE University Graduate Business School, employing culinary arts to teach sustainability. Michael, with extensive industrial decarbonization experience, created the course, while Ekaterina contributed her expertise in sustainable business education as a cofacilitator.
